Embedded Gatekeeper

 

 

Gatekeeper Basics

Introduction

Gatekeepers are optional within H.323 networks. However, when they are present, gateways (voip units) and other network endpoint devices (like terminals and Multipoint Control Units used in conferences) must use gatekeeper services. There are four functions that H.323 gatekeepers must provide to the network and many other functions, both standard and proprietary, that the gatekeeper may offer to network participants.

Mandatory Gatekeeper Functions

The mandatory gatekeeper functions are address translation, admission control, bandwidth control, and zone management.

Address Translation

The gatekeeper supports aliases, such as conventional E.164 phone numbers, for each endpoint registered within the zone. Users call each other within a zone by simply dialing a number or string of characters instead of an IP address. This function is particularly important when a phone on the circuit- switched network tries to call a phone connected to a gateway on an IP network.

Admission Control

The gatekeeper determines which network participants can and cannot make calls, according to established network permissions and rules. The gatekeeper controls admission using H.225 “RAS” messages (Registration, Admission, Status).

Bandwidth Control

With the MultiVOIP Gatekeeper, the network administrator can specify bandwidth limitations within a gatekeeper’s zone and can specify a bandwidth limit for gateway endpoints. The gatekeeper controls bandwidth using H.225 RAS messages. A gatekeeper may determine there is no bandwidth available for a call or no additional bandwidth available for an ongoing call requesting an increase. Dynamic (situation-dependent) changes in bandwidth allocation are typically called “bandwidth management,” which is considered an optional gatekeeper function.
